The period of air journey between Charlotte Douglas Worldwide Airport (CLT) and Miami Worldwide Airport (MIA) is usually round one hour and forty-five minutes to 2 hours. A number of components can affect the precise time en route, together with air site visitors management, climate situations, and the precise flight path chosen by the airline. Continuous flights typically provide the quickest journey time, whereas connecting flights will naturally add to the general period of the journey.

4. Climate Circumstances
Climate situations symbolize a major issue influencing flight period between Charlotte and Miami. Atmospheric variations, from routine wind patterns to extreme storms, can affect flight paths, cruising speeds, and even the flexibility to take off or land on schedule. Understanding the affect of climate on flight instances is essential for correct journey planning and managing expectations.
-
Wind Patterns
Prevailing winds alongside the flight path can both speed up or decelerate an plane. Headwinds, opposing the course of journey, enhance flight time, whereas tailwinds, pushing the plane ahead, can scale back it. The Charlotte-Miami route will be affected by various wind patterns, significantly throughout sure seasons, impacting the general period of the flight.
-
Storms and Precipitation
Thunderstorms, hurricanes, and heavy precipitation may cause vital flight delays and even cancellations. These climate occasions necessitate rerouting plane round affected areas, rising flight instances and doubtlessly resulting in diversions to alternate airports. The southeastern United States, encompassing each Charlotte and Miami, experiences its justifiable share of extreme climate, making this a pertinent issue for vacationers.
-
Visibility
Decreased visibility attributable to fog, haze, or heavy cloud cowl can affect each departure and arrival instances. Low visibility situations usually require plane to fly at lowered speeds or implement instrument approaches, rising the time required for takeoff and touchdown procedures. Whereas much less widespread than wind or storms, visibility points can nonetheless contribute to delays on the Charlotte-Miami route.
-
Temperature
Excessive temperatures, each excessive and low, can have an effect on plane efficiency. Excessive temperatures scale back air density, requiring longer takeoff distances and doubtlessly impacting climb charges. Conversely, extraordinarily chilly temperatures necessitate de-icing procedures, which may delay departures. Whereas temperature fluctuations are much less more likely to trigger vital delays on the comparatively quick Charlotte-Miami route in comparison with longer flights, they continue to be an element to think about.
